I understand how frustrating it is to receive a tune without any instructions. Here is what you can usually do while waiting for the official guide from RR Racing.
  1. Check what exactly they sent you
    Most kits include an OBD cable or a USB stick, or a link to download software. Sometimes you also get a tune file or a code to activate it.
  2. If there is a link or USB, install the software on a Windows laptop
    macOS is usually not supported. It might be RR Racing’s own software or something based on EcuTek.
  3. Connect your laptop to the car through the OBD port
    The port is usually located under the steering wheel. Turn the ignition on but do not start the engine.
  4. Open the software and check if it detects the ECU
    There might be an option to read your current tune or flash the new one. The car might turn on and off during this process. That is normal. Just make sure not to lose power or disconnect anything.
  5. After the flash, let the ECU adapt
    Let the car idle for a bit and drive normally so the system adjusts to the new tune.
If you did not receive any software or files, check your email including spam. If nothing is there, contact RR Racing and ask for the missing files or instructions. Their support is usually helpful but may take a day or two to reply.
